yavot-py
yavot-py is a modern, fast, and fully type-safe Python library for interacting with the Yandex Video Translation API. This library is a Python port of the popular TypeScript library vot.js.
It allows you to request video translations, poll processing status, obtain translated voice-over audio URLs, fetch original and translated subtitles, download and convert subtitle formats, and translate live streams in real time.

Quick Start
Async Client (Recommended)
The core client uses httpx.AsyncClient underneath.
import asyncio
import httpx
from vot import VOTClient, get_video_data
async def main():
# Initialize HTTP client
async with httpx.AsyncClient() as http_client:
# Initialize VOTClient
client = VOTClient(client=http_client)
# Resolve video URL (automatically detects service, extracts video ID & metadata)
url = "https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=dQw4w9WgXcQ"
video_data = await get_video_data(url, client=http_client)
print(f"Service: {video_data.host}, Video ID: {video_data.video_id}")
# Request video translation
response = await client.translate_video(video_data)
if response.translated:
print(f"Translation finished! Audio URL: {response.url}")
else:
print(f"Translation in progress. Retry in {response.remaining_time}s. (Status: {response.status})")
if __name__ == "__main__":
asyncio.run(main())
Sync Client
If your application uses synchronous code, you can use VOTClientSync, which handles the event loop automatically.
from vot import VOTClientSync, get_video_data
import httpx
# VOTClientSync supports the context manager protocol
with VOTClientSync() as client:
# Resolving video data still requires an HTTP client
with httpx.Client() as http_client:
# Since get_video_data is async, we run it using the client's loop runner helper
video_data = client._run(get_video_data("https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=dQw4w9WgXcQ"))
# Request translation synchronously
response = client.translate_video(video_data)
if response.translated:
print(f"Voiceover Audio URL: {response.url}")
Key Features & Modules
Service Routing & ID Extraction
get_video_data parses a video page URL, matches it against a registry of supported hosting sites (YouTube, Vimeo, Twitch, VK, TikTok, custom direct links, etc.), extracts the identifier, and returns a structured VideoData object.
from vot import get_video_data
# YouTube support includes watch links, shorts, live streams, embed links, and share URLs
video_data = await get_video_data("https://youtu.be/dQw4w9WgXcQ")
print(video_data.video_id) # "dQw4w9WgXcQ"
print(video_data.host) # "youtube"
Video Translation
translate_video serializes a Protobuf payload and sends a signed request to Yandex API.
- Translation Settings:
request_lang: Source video language (e.g."en","de","zh", or"auto").response_lang: Target translation language (e.g."ru","en","kk").
- Initial YouTube Videos Upload: For brand new YouTube videos that have never been translated by Yandex before, Yandex requires uploading a mock audio player error report (
fail-audio-js). This library performs that upload automatically ifshould_send_failed_audio=True(default).
Fetching Subtitles
get_subtitles retrieves a list of available subtitles, containing links to the original subtitles as well as machine-translated subtitles generated by Yandex.
subs_response = await client.get_subtitles(video_data)
for sub in subs_response.subtitles:
print(f"Original Language: {sub.language} -> URL: {sub.url}")
if sub.translated_url:
print(f"Translated to: {sub.translated_language} -> URL: {sub.translated_url}")
Live Streams
The library supports translating ongoing live broadcasts.
translate_stream— Initiates stream translation and returns an M3U8 translated playlist URL.ping_stream— Sends periodic keep-alive requests to keep the translation session alive.
stream_res = await client.translate_stream(video_data)
if stream_res.translated:
print(f"Translated stream M3U8: {stream_res.result.url}")
# Run ping loop in the background to maintain session
await client.ping_stream(stream_res.ping_id)
Subtitles Conversion
convert_subs allows converting between JSON (Yandex's internal format), SRT, and VTT formats:
from vot import convert_subs
# Convert VTT format to SRT
vtt_data = "WEBVTT\n\n00:00:01.000 --> 00:00:03.000\nHello, world!"
srt_data = convert_subs(vtt_data, output="srt")
print(srt_data)
# Output:
# 1
# 00:00:01,000 --> 00:00:03,000
# Hello, world!
# Convert VTT to Yandex JSON format
json_data = convert_subs(vtt_data, output="json")
CLI Usage
The library includes a CLI tool that prints response URLs, polls translation status, and downloads audio or subtitles.
Running the CLI
Depending on your installation, you can run the CLI in one of the following ways:
- If installed:
vot <args> - Locally (during development, using the helper script):
./vot-cli <args> - Directly via Python:
python -m vot.cli <args> # Or via uv: uv run python -m vot.cli <args>
CLI Arguments
| Option | Shorthand | Description | Default |
|---|---|---|---|
url |
Positioned | URL of the video to translate (e.g. YouTube, Vimeo, Twitch, VK, TikTok) | Required |
--lang-from |
-f |
Source language of the video (e.g., en, de, zh, or auto) |
en |
--lang-to |
-t |
Target language of the translation (e.g., ru, en, kk) |
ru |
--output |
-o |
Save the translated audio file to this local path | None |
--subtitles |
-s |
Fetch and print available subtitle links | False |
--output-subs |
Save the translated subtitles file to this local path (supports .srt, .vtt, .json) |
None |
Examples
-
Get translation audio link (with status polling):
vot https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=dQw4w9WgXcQ
-
Translate from German to Russian and download the audio locally:
vot https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=dQw4w9WgXcQ -f de -t ru -o output.mp3
-
Request translation and print subtitle links:
vot https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=dQw4w9WgXcQ -s
-
Download and convert subtitles to SRT:
vot https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=dQw4w9WgXcQ --output-subs subs.srt
